- JWT authentication with Supabase integration - Role-based access control (Admin, Owner, Staff, Auditor) - Universal database adapter (Prisma/Supabase/MongoDB support) - User management with hierarchical permissions - Redis caching service (configured but optional) - Comprehensive API documentation - Production-ready NestJS architecture - Migration scripts for provider switching - Swagger/OpenAPI documentation
5 lines
130 B
TypeScript
5 lines
130 B
TypeScript
import { registerAs } from '@nestjs/config';
|
|
|
|
export default registerAs('database', () => ({
|
|
url: process.env.DATABASE_URL,
|
|
})); |